Transaction 3c52e95c8c96452120c4d9caef77a189966b1253fd1a74ad7dfc874134dbc573
1 Input
1 Output
-
3c52e95c8c96452120c4d9caef77a189966b1253fd1a74ad7dfc874134dbc573:0
- value
- 2043436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56cd623f19ebef7f81a374199ee75b7f3cdafefb OP_EQUAL
- address
- 39bz5Mc2Zg9FjwwTTTV64wKQeXDa128yn6